Perform a wide variety of job functions associated with maintaining inventory integrity and improving efficiencies throughout the distribution center.


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

Perform order adjustments (repicks).


Monitor, research, and resolve allocation issues in the Problem Resolution (Orders) program.


Perform inventory transfers and adjustments as needed.


Print and apply location label requests.


Request repair and replacement of RF and Vocollect units.


Review and research various reports.


Research inventory discrepancies and explains large quantity on hand adjustments.


Perform all jobs functions associated with processing stray parts.


Research and correct item numbers and locations in the LogPro Quantity Correction program.


Audit outbound parcels and inbound license plates daily and verify results.


Perform daily audits and reconcile all items located in damage locations.


Perform all job functions associated with relabel and changeover projects which includes processing items in the “relabel” location.


Perform slotting jobs determined by the DC and the Slotting Task Force Leader.


Maintain correct rule sets and assignments.


Help maintain accurate dimensional data.


Ensure the process of safe weight on beams.


Perform all job functions associated with Factory Stock Adjustments, Factory Stock Lifts, Final Sweeps and Recalls.


Perform daily cycle counts of select Freon item numbers.


Perform a monthly inventory of critical supply items.


Cycle count each DC location at least once per trimester and perform a Return Department Verification each quarter.


Assist in maintaining ship percentage with on hand and DC shrink goals.


Keep all work areas neat and clean, including cleanup of any spills that occur while performing job duties.


Maintain safety standards while operating and identify unsafe practices and situations.


Team members with experience may be designated as trainers. As a trainer, take ownership of the DC target training program ensuring that all training is conducted according to schedule, and that all documentation is complete. Explain specific job duties/functions to help ensure success of new team members, as well as to convey any departmental or procedural changes to existing team members.


All other duties as assigned.
